Euro Posted a Huge Decline against Dollar

EUR/USD declined today to its new minimum level since June 13 after a bearish commentaries by Jean-Claude Trichet that followed ECB’s rate decision. Even bad reports on U.S. employment and housing couldn’t save the currency pair from falling. It is now trading near 1.5326 level.
Initial jobless claims rose to 455,000 last week, up from 448,000 a week before. Analysts estimated a decline to 420,000 claims for the last week.
Pending home sales rose by 5.3% in United States in June. This growth followed 4.9% decline in May. Median forecast for the June was at 1% decline.
Consumer credit rose by $14.3 billion in June. That’s above the recorded $8 billion May growth and exceeds $6.4 billion analytics’ estimate for June.
